    How To Watch ‘Fast & Furious’ Movies In Order

    Fast & Furious is easily one of the biggest action franchises in Hollywood. Starting out in 2001 with ‘The Fast and the Furious’, initially, the films focused on illegal racing. It culminated in 2009 and quickly transitioned into a series about spying and heists with ‘Fast Five.’

    Since there are so many films in the ever-growing franchise, it is really hard to keep a track of everyone. So here we will decode how to watch these movies in order, both in chronological as well as release order. So sit back, relax, and enjoy reading about this action franchise.

    ‘Fast & Furious’ In Chronological Order

    The ‘Fast & Furious‘ franchise has been growing since 2001 and has nine films under its bucket, several spin-offs, short films, and an animated series. Over the years, it has transitioned from a racing franchise to something that focuses mainly on spies and heists. Here is the complete chronological order of the film.

    1. The Fast and the Furious‘ (2001)

    2. The Turbo Charged Prelude for 2 Fast 2 Furious‘ (2003 short film)

    3. 2 Fast 2 Furious‘ (2003)

    4. Los Bandoleros (2009 short film)

    5. Fast & Furious‘ (2009)

    6. Fast Five‘ (2011)

    7. Fast & Furious 6‘ (2013)

    8. The Fast and the Furious: Tokyo Drift‘ (2006)

    9. ‘Furious 7‘ (2015)

    10. ‘The Fate of the Furious‘ (2017)

    11. ‘Fast & Furious Presents: Hobbs and Shaw‘ (2019)

    12. ‘F9‘ (2021)

    13. ‘Fast X‘ (2023)

    ‘Fast & Furious’ Movies In Release Order

    People who are new to this action-packed franchise should simply stick to the release date order. Since there are two short films and one spin-off (‘Hobbs & Shaw‘) between the main films. The main films, also called the Fast Saga, also spawned an animated show titled ‘Fast & Furious Spy Racers.’

    1. The Fast and the Furious‘ (June 22, 2001)
    2. The Turbo Charged Prelude for 2 Fast 2 Furious‘ (2003 short films)
    3. 2 Fast 2 Furious‘ (June 6, 2003)
    4. The Fast and the Furious: Tokyo Drift‘ (June 16, 2006)
    5. ‘Fast & Furious’ (April 3, 2009)
    6. ‘Los Bandoleros’ (2009 short film)
    7. ‘Fast Five’ (April 29, 2011)
    8. ‘Fast & Furious 6’ (May 24, 2013)
    9. ‘Furious 7’ (April 3, 2015)
    10. ‘The Fate of the Furious’ (April 14, 2017)
    11. ‘Hobbs & Shaw’ (August 2, 2019, spinoff film)
    12. ‘F9’ (June 25, 2021)
    13. ‘Fast X’ (May 19, 2023)
